DIPA Announces Ten New Candidates - More to Follow

The Democratic Alignment (DIPA) is announcing ten new candidates today for the upcoming parliamentary elections. Among them are Nestor Nestor, former head of the Greek Cypriot side of the Committee on Missing Persons (CMP) and former president of NEDIK, who will be a candidate in the province of Nicosia, and Loizos Michael, who recently resigned from DISY and will be a candidate in Limassol. The announcement of candidates will continue in the coming days, with the possibility of announcing another ten candidates by the end of the week and another ten before the end of the month. The final announcement, towards the end of January, will include the remaining candidates. The party's Political Committee will meet in the next few days to review the pre-election course, set goals and the main message of the campaign. The intentions of the party president, Marios Karoyian, are also expected to be clarified, with indications suggesting that he is unlikely to be a candidate. It is worth noting that DIPA announced its first ten candidates on December 19, which included four honorary and six party officials.
